1 definition by palmanshippens

Top Definition
The most beautiful girl in existence. A heart that is of gold and when she smiles she lights up the room. Her eyes are captivating and Jesus shines through her. She is very outgoing and loves to love people. You cant help but want to be around her because her joy is addicting. Men fall in love because her bod is outta this world. She is perfect. Wonderful. Glorious. Pure. Enjoyable. Loving. Amazing.
Why does every girl try when they can be just like an Audrye?
by palmanshippens November 18, 2010
Mug icon
Buy a Audrye mug!